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
525525 313 805 663464585
24166117526 756051 83580
24166117526 756051 83580
79 0421049392 37698 892160 7202
All about undefined
Interested in learning more?
24166117526 756051 83580
79 0421049392 37698 892160 7202
See more
6837491902 36 397
85 08286450589 30506 626
See more
464 39827
687 61 8913 651453
See more